What is Ferrous Fumarate?
Ferrous fumarate is a type of iron supplement that contains iron in a form that is easily absorbed by the body. It is a salt of fumaric acid and ferrous iron, making it a popular choice for treating and preventing iron deficiency anemia. Unlike some other forms of iron, ferrous fumarate is known for its lower gastrointestinal side effects, making it more tolerable for many individuals.
Benefits of Ferrous Fumarate
1. Effective Treatment for Iron Deficiency Anemia
One of the primary uses of ferrous fumarate is to treat iron deficiency anemia, a condition characterized by a lack of adequate healthy red blood cells due to insufficient iron. Symptoms may include fatigue, weakness, and pale skin. By providing a readily absorbable source of iron, ferrous fumarate can help restore healthy iron levels in the body.
2. Better Absorption
Ferrous fumarate is known for its high bioavailability, which means that the body can absorb and utilize it more effectively than some other iron supplements. This makes it a preferred option for individuals who may struggle with iron absorption.
3. Lower Gastrointestinal Side Effects
Many people experience gastrointestinal discomfort when taking iron supplements. However, ferrous fumarate tends to be gentler on the stomach, leading to fewer side effects such as constipation, nausea, or stomach cramps. This is particularly important for those who need to take iron supplements regularly.
4. Supports Overall Health
Iron is vital for various bodily functions, including oxygen transport, energy production, and immune system support. By ensuring adequate iron levels through supplements like ferrous fumarate, individuals can promote overall health and well-being.
How to Take Ferrous Fumarate
Ferrous fumarate is typically available in tablet or liquid form. It is essential to follow the dosage instructions provided by a healthcare professional, as excessive iron intake can lead to toxicity. Generally, it’s recommended to take ferrous fumarate on an empty stomach for optimal absorption, although some may need to take it with food to minimize stomach upset.
Who Should Consider Ferrous Fumarate?
Ferrous fumarate is often recommended for:
– Individuals with iron deficiency anemia
– Pregnant women, who require higher iron levels
– Vegetarians and vegans, who may struggle to get enough iron from their diet
– People with heavy menstrual periods, which can lead to increased iron loss
